As Ramon Forcada joins the team KlaffiThroughout the last 15 years, the Assen round has become a favourite on the Superbike calendar. This year Assen has a modified race track.
The original course with its almost 6 kilometres was shortened to a more modest distance of
4.555 km. So the TT Circuit at Assen is a new track for the Superbike riders.
In Free Practice yesterday morning Alex had to get acquainted to the course. And he did it rather well. With a 1'41.227 lap time he was second fastest after Troy Bayliss. In the first Qualifying later in the afternoon Alex improved his lap time. With a 1'40.415 he finished 5th.
Team Manager Klaus Klaffenböck said: "The first sessions today were rather okay for us. Position 5 in Friday's Qualifying is much better than at the last two events. – The conditions are nearly perfect and additional to this there is a new team member to join us. It is our new crew chief Ramon Forcada. He worked several years for Alex in MotoGP and will be with us at Assen, Imola and Magny Cours.
So Ramon has two jobs from now just to the end of the season. He is working for Casey Stoner in MotoGP and for Team Klaffi Honda in World's Superbike."
